Why do washing machines take so much longer in europe than in the US? |
Travel Info Seriously, it take nearly three times longer to wash the same amount of clothes. Travel Tips European W/D typically use less water and I think the cycles are longer to ensure the soap gets rinsed out. Also, they typically spin the clothes very fast (in England they have separate machines just to spin clothes) so that they require less time in the dryer. I seem to remember an extra spin cycle which would make the process take longer as well. These measure are designed to a) decrease water consumption b) decrease electrical consumption Source(s): personal experience in UK, Spain, Italy Other Travel Tips You're most likely simply not comparing like with like. Plenty of models in Europe have the "fuzzy logic" features which can shorten wash times. I'd suspect you've simply had bad luck with the models you've used.
